No, aspirants applying for BA LLB, BBA LLB and LLB courses have to only apply for MHCET Law and its counselling. Candidates do not have fill out the ILS Law College form for these courses. They have to fill out the college form for LLM and diploma courses.
Admission to ILS Law College in Pune requires high score in MH CET Law exam with General category cutoffs often exceeding 97-99%. Applicants must have completed 10+2 with a minimum of 45% (40% for SC/ST) for 5 year course or Bachelor degree for the 3 year LLB. Application process is managed by CET Cell Maharashtra.
Yes it is definitely worth joining ILS Law College for a BA LLB as it is consistently ranked among the top 10-15 law schools in India. Known for its excellent reputation. BA LLB placements at ILS Law College are regarded satisfactory. The college has a specialised Training and Placement Cell that manages campus placements for graduating students. Companies that engage in ILS Law College's placement efforts include Cipla, CityCorp, Credit Suisse, HSBC, ICICI Bank, Kotak Mahindra, Larsen & Toubro Infotech Ltd., Vedanta, and Tech Mahindra.
The official ILS law College BA LLB seat allotment cutoffs are released round-by-round by the CET Cell during the Centralized Admission Process (CAP), which typically starts between July and August following the declaration of the entrance results.

To obtain an LLM at ILS Law College, you must first meet the Eligibility Criteria, which requires a bachelor's degree in law. Complete the ILS Law College Pune application form. The link to purchase the prospectus and application form is available on the college's official website. The college publishes merit lists based on candidates' bachelor's degree scores. Candidates are shortlisted based on their marks. Candidates whose names are on the merit list must attend a personal interview. The final selection of candidates is based on their performance in both rounds. The LLM programme at ILS Law College is a two-year programme with a maximum admission of 60 students each year.
The most recent cutoff information for admission to the BA LLB degree at ILS Law College is based on the Maharashtra Law Common Entrance Test (CET) result.For the Five-Year BA LLB Program, the final MHCET Law Round 1 rank was 119.Candidates can predict the closing ranks for the BA LLB cutoff 2024 to be between 112 and 126 in Round 1.The college does not hold a separate entrance examination. Admissions are provided by the CET Cell in Mumbai under the Centralized Admission Process (CAP).
The fee details for various UG courses at ILS Law College are total fee for Bachelor of Arts and Bachelor of Laws (BA LLB) was INR 1.9 Lakhs, the total fee for Bachelor of Laws (LLB) was INR 1.12 Lakhs, total fee for Diploma in Medical Jurisprudence and Forensic Science was INR 10,000, total fee for Post Graduate Diploma in Alternate Dispute Resolution (ADR) was INR 40,250, total fee for Bachelor of Business Administration (BBA) + Bachelor of Laws (LLB) {Hons.} was INR 1.12 Lakhs.
Admission to the BA LLB programme at ILS Law College is contingent upon completing certain eligibility requirements.Candidates for BA LLB (Five-Year Integrated Program) must have completed 10+2 or equivalent from any recognised board of education.General candidates need at least 45%.SC/ST candidates need at least 40%.Admissions are based on the results of the MH CET LAW (Maharashtra Law Common Entrance Test) administered by the Directorate of Higher Education, Maharashtra.The exam is administered online.Interested candidates can apply online via the MH CET LAW Portal.

The BA LLB cutoffs at ILS Law College are determined in the Centralized Admission Process (CAP) based on basis of four factors, which are:
MAH 5-Year LLB CET Score: Rank or percentile in the state entrance exam is the primary criteria.
Seat Availability: It also depends on the seats, which is 240 in BA LLB at ILS Law College.
Reservation Quotas: Cutoffs depend on candidates category (General, SC, ST, OBC) and whether they belong to Maharashtra State (MS) or All India (OMS).
Applicant Preferences: How many top-ranking students lock in ILS Pune as their first choice on the CAP portal directly dictates how high the cutoff closes.

ILS follows a refund policy in case of cancellation or withdrawal of admissions. Below are the details:
| % of Refund of Fees | Point of time when notice of withdrawal of admission is received |
|---|---|
| 100% | 15 days or more before the formally notified last date of admission |
| 90% | Less than 15 days before the formally notified last date ot admission |
| 80% | 15 days or less after the formally notified last date of admission |
| 50% | 30 days or less, but more than 1S days after formally notified last date of admission |
| 00% | More than 30 days after formally notified last date of admission |

ILS Law College offers Diploma in Taxation Laws and Labour Laws & Labour Welfare for one academic year each. Aspirants need to complete graduation to apply for Diploma programme. Admission is merit-based.

ILS Law College offers admission in 160 seats of LLB. The seats are filled via Maharashtra State-level Counselling based on MHCET Law scores of the aspirants. Those who are allotted seat have to report at the college for document verification and fee payment.
